[DRE-commits] [chef-zero] 02/02: new upstream release + relax hashie dependency
Antonio Terceiro
terceiro at moszumanska.debian.org
Wed Jul 15 21:05:16 UTC 2015
This is an automated email from the git hooks/post-receive script.
terceiro pushed a commit to branch master
in repository chef-zero.
commit ec75efaacb5458556e354219b9f24f7a50add612
Author: Antonio Terceiro <terceiro at debian.org>
Date: Wed Jul 15 18:00:03 2015 -0300
new upstream release + relax hashie dependency
---
debian/changelog | 7 ++++++
.../0001-Remove-implicit-dependency-on-chef.patch | 6 +----
.../patches/0004-Relax-dependency-on-hashie.patch | 29 ++++++++++++++++++++++
debian/patches/series | 1 +
4 files changed, 38 insertions(+), 5 deletions(-)
diff --git a/debian/changelog b/debian/changelog
index d73efa8..3e1f380 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,10 @@
+chef-zero (4.2.3-1) unstable; urgency=medium
+
+ * New upstream release
+ * add patch to relax dependency on ruby-hashie
+
+ -- Antonio Terceiro <terceiro at debian.org> Wed, 15 Jul 2015 18:01:18 -0300
+
chef-zero (4.2.2-1) unstable; urgency=medium
* New upstream release
diff --git a/debian/patches/0001-Remove-implicit-dependency-on-chef.patch b/debian/patches/0001-Remove-implicit-dependency-on-chef.patch
index 483ecaa..6c3d405 100644
--- a/debian/patches/0001-Remove-implicit-dependency-on-chef.patch
+++ b/debian/patches/0001-Remove-implicit-dependency-on-chef.patch
@@ -1,7 +1,6 @@
-From eb78e23269692086421b35c23857064df8535b34 Mon Sep 17 00:00:00 2001
From: Antonio Terceiro <terceiro at debian.org>
Date: Sun, 14 Jun 2015 15:57:45 -0300
-Subject: [PATCH 1/2] Remove implicit dependency on chef
+Subject: Remove implicit dependency on chef
You don't want chef-zero depending on chef, since chef already depends
on chef-zero and circular dependencies are a pain to deal with.
@@ -36,6 +35,3 @@ index 83d503c..ddb2e9b 100644
false
end
---
-2.1.4
-
diff --git a/debian/patches/0004-Relax-dependency-on-hashie.patch b/debian/patches/0004-Relax-dependency-on-hashie.patch
new file mode 100644
index 0000000..f9da9dc
--- /dev/null
+++ b/debian/patches/0004-Relax-dependency-on-hashie.patch
@@ -0,0 +1,29 @@
+From: Antonio Terceiro <terceiro at debian.org>
+Date: Wed, 15 Jul 2015 17:58:49 -0300
+Subject: Relax dependency on hashie
+
+---
+ metadata.yml | 4 ++--
+ 1 file changed, 2 insertions(+), 2 deletions(-)
+
+diff --git a/metadata.yml b/metadata.yml
+index d56eeca..9a50db0 100644
+--- a/metadata.yml
++++ b/metadata.yml
+@@ -28,14 +28,14 @@ dependencies:
+ name: hashie
+ requirement: !ruby/object:Gem::Requirement
+ requirements:
+- - - "~>"
++ - - ">="
+ - !ruby/object:Gem::Version
+ version: '2.0'
+ type: :runtime
+ prerelease: false
+ version_requirements: !ruby/object:Gem::Requirement
+ requirements:
+- - - "~>"
++ - - ">="
+ - !ruby/object:Gem::Version
+ version: '2.0'
+ - !ruby/object:Gem::Dependency
diff --git a/debian/patches/series b/debian/patches/series
index 8aaac19..800e4b2 100644
--- a/debian/patches/series
+++ b/debian/patches/series
@@ -1,3 +1,4 @@
0001-Remove-requires-of-rubygems-and-bundler.patch
0002-Add-missing-require-statement.patch
0001-Remove-implicit-dependency-on-chef.patch
+0004-Relax-dependency-on-hashie.patch
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ruby-extras/chef-zero.git
More information about the Pkg-ruby-extras-commits
mailing list